    Hi All

    Maybe I have missed an update or something along the wat but my Website builder has stopped publishing all of a sudden

    I took a screen shot but I would attached here. I get an error message that says "The connection with the server has been reset"

    I have used Bluevoda for a year now and not once have I changed any settings on it as everything was running nicely.

    Can anybody shed some light on this for me?

    any help would be greatly appreciated

    Re: Website Builder has stopped Publishing

    As long as you have been using it regularly and you haven't changed any of the publishing info i.e. ip, username, password etc then just try it again in a bit.

    If it persist check your ip is correct, you may have changed it accidentally on the drop down, check your user name, password and publishing folder is correct.
